What is High-Frequency Insulation Resistance Testing?
High-Frequency Insulation Resistance Testing is a non-destructive laboratory service that evaluates the effectiveness of an electrical systems insulation against high-frequency voltage. This test applies AC (alternating current) voltages at frequencies up to 5 kHz, simulating real-world conditions and pushing the insulation to its limits.
Unlike traditional insulation resistance tests, HFIRT doesnt rely on DC (direct current) voltages, which can provide misleading results due to capacitive and inductive effects. By using high-frequency AC voltage, Eurolabs expert technicians can accurately assess an electrical systems insulation integrity, even when the presence of moisture or contaminants may compromise the accuracy of traditional tests.

What is the Process of High-Frequency Insulation Resistance Testing?
At Eurolab, our expert technicians follow a rigorous process to ensure accurate and reliable results:
1. Pre-Test Preparation: We carefully prepare your equipment for testing by cleaning and drying it to prevent contamination.
2. High-Frequency Voltage Application: Our advanced testing equipment applies high-frequency AC voltage to the insulation system under test.
3. Data Collection and Analysis: Our expert technicians collect data on the insulation resistance, including measurements at various frequencies and voltages.
4. Reporting and Recommendations: We provide a comprehensive report detailing our findings, including recommendations for corrective action if necessary.
